In 2008 Resources for Change completed an Audience Development and Access Plan for Milton Mount Gardens (Worth Park) in Crawley, West Sussex.
The work was commissioned by Crawley Borough Council as part of their preparations to submit a proposal to the Heritage Lottery Fund’s Parks for People Grant Programme.
Working with Land Management Services over six months we consulted the local community to understand how they use the park and how facilities could be improved to increase and broaden use.
The consultation involved over 300 members of the public and key informants. A variety of tools were used to build an understanding of how the park is used and valued at present and to develop ideas for the future.
A range of action points were identified that had the potential to significantly increase and broaden the number of visits to the park and to increase the level of awareness of its heritage value and levels of enjoyment.
